425 サイドグルーブ導入DCB試験片を用いた高分子材料の破壊特性評価(GS-11 複合材料(1))

Three dimensional stress state of side-grooved DCB specimen was investigated on the basis of numerical results of elastic-plastic finite element analysis. An estimation formula based on the conventional compliance method was also derived for calculating the mode I energy release rate of the side-grooved specimen. The effects of side-groove on the stress distribution in the vicinity of the crack tip were clarified by the finite element results. The results also showed that the estimation formula was valid even for the specimen involving a small plastic region around the crack tip.
